如何将外部js文件添加到Laravel项目的app.js文件中?

时间:2018-12-14 18:03:12

标签: javascript node.js laravel webpack

我想使用this包进行音频均衡动画。我想将其添加到我的Laravel项目中,所以我复制了两个文件

jquery.reverseorder.js
jquery.equalizer.js

/myproject/node_modules/myjss/

并添加了这两行

import 'myjss/jquery.equalizer'
import 'myjss/jquery.reverseorder'

进入/myproject/resources/js/app.js

但它返回TypeError: $(...).equalizer is not a function

我该如何解决?

1 个答案:

答案 0 :(得分:0)

您不需要像这样保存这些文件。只需将它们保存在laravel的资产文件夹中即可。然后在laravel中,您应该像这样<script type="text/javascript" src="js/jquery.reverseorder.js"></script>一样包含它。在src路径中,您可以使用laravel的asset_path。您可以将此路径包含在js或laravel的刀片模板中。